Mystery Solved


Since I am usually rushing out the door in the morning, I fill the bird feeders at night, when I let Danny out to play.

I have noticed that the feeders are usually empty in the morning which is very strange, because birds (and squirrels) sleep at night. I thought it could be a raccoon or possum or perhaps the deer that are constantly in the yard. Everyone laughed at the idea of deer eating my bird feed.

The picture on the right is proof! As I watched, 2 deer came to eat the seed. They tilt the feeder and then stick their tongues in to pull out the seed. If it is tough battling the squirrels, the deer may be impossible.
